Jun 7, 2023 · One of the UN’s strengths is helping entire nations to save millions of dollars on conducting peacekeeping operations. To compare, the UN mission in Haiti cost $428 million whereas a similar U.S. operation would have cost twice as much (US Government Accountability Office 7). The League of Nations founded in 1920, on the initiative of Woodrow Wilson, the President of the US, could not avert the Second World War (1939-1945).
